I'm curious if any of you have grown a Dove Tree - variously known as a Handkerchief tree or a Ghost tree. If you have, I'd love to know how long it took between the time you planted it and its first bloom. Some of the articles tell me it could be 15 years! Is that really true? Also, what are the differences between the Robinia Pseudoacacia Frisia and the Sunburst Honeylocust? Again, are the habits substantially different, or the up and downsides?
Dove Tree
Sorry, I've never grown a dove tree - it's not hardy in my zone (bummer). There is a selection called 'Sonoma', I think, that will bloom while in a 5 gallon pot. It also has much larger "flowers" than the species. If you plant the species, you could wait a few years to see it bloom.
Regarding Robina 'Frisia' and Gleditsia 'Sunburst'. 'Frisia' will retain its golden color all season. 'Sunburst' has growth that starts out gold and turns green after a couple of weeks. New growth on the 'Sunburst' is always gold. 'Frisia' has much larger leaflets than 'Sunburst'. 'Frisia' is usually grafted on plain Robinia understock and may have a tendency to sucker. I have never seen a 'Sunburst' locust sucker.
Both are nice trees. It just depends on whether you want a tree that is gold all year or not.
